Joan Baez Praises Monica Barbaro’s Portrayal Of Her In ‘A Complete Unknown’

In a new interview with the Marin Independent Journal, Joan Baez praised Monica Barbaro‘s portrayal of her in the Bob Dylan biopic, A Complete Unknown. “If I didn’t think she was good at it, I probably wouldn’t have enjoyed it in general,” Baez said. “But she looked enough like me and she had my gestures down. You could tell who it was. She worked so hard. Kudos to her for taking the role on.” The Academy Award-nominated film depicts Baez’s early relationship with Dylan and their involvement in the ’60s folk movement, and Baez appreciated the representation of her life and music in the film. “I thought the music was fantastic,” she said. “I may be blocking my feelings, but it’s an amusing movie. It was fun.” A Complete Unknown has received eight Oscar nominations, including Best Picture and Best Actor for Timothée Chalamet’s portrayal of Dylan. (Consequence of Sound)
